做作业拼音怎么写
【做作业拼音怎么写】在日常学习中,很多学生或家长可能会遇到“做作业拼音怎么写”这样的问题。尤其是在刚开始学习拼音的时候,很多人对如何正确书写“做作业”这几个字的拼音感到困惑。本文将从拼音的基本规则出发,总结“做作业”的拼音写法,并通过表格形式清晰展示。
【C语言中的函数形参为void是什么意思】在C语言中,函数的定义和调用是程序设计的基础之一。函数的参数列表决定了调用时可以传递的数据类型和数量。其中,“`void`”是一个特殊的关键词,常用于函数的形参列表中。下面将对“C语言中的函数形参为`void`是什么意思”进行总结,并通过表格形式清晰展示其含义与使用场景。
一、
在C语言中,当一个函数的形参列表中使用了`void`,表示该函数不接受任何参数。也就是说,这个函数在被调用时不需要传递任何值或变量。这种写法通常用于那些不需要外部输入、仅执行特定操作的函数。
例如:
```c
void printHello() {
printf("Hello, World!\n");
}
```
在这个例子中,`printHello()`函数没有形参,因此在调用时无需传入任何参数。
此外,`void`还可以作为函数返回值类型,表示该函数不返回任何值。这与函数形参中的`void`是不同的概念,但都属于C语言中`void`的常见用法。
需要注意的是,如果一个函数的形参列表中只写`void`,则不能同时有其他参数。例如:
```c
void func(void) { ... } // 正确:不接受任何参数
void func(int a) { ... } // 正确:接受一个int类型的参数
void func(void, int a) { ... } // 错误:语法错误
```
二、表格对比
| 内容 | 说明 |
| 函数形参为 void 的含义 | 表示该函数在调用时不接受任何参数。 |
| 函数返回值为 void 的含义 | 表示该函数在执行后不返回任何值。 |
| 函数定义格式 | `返回类型 函数名(形参列表)` 如:`void func(void);` |
| 是否允许其他参数 | 不允许。若形参列表中出现`void`,则不能有其他参数。 |
| 典型应用场景 | 用于无参数的函数,如初始化函数、打印信息函数等。 |
| 注意事项 | 在C语言中,`void`在形参列表中表示“无参数”,而`void`在返回类型中表示“无返回值”。两者不可混淆。 |
三、结语
在C语言中,`void`是一个非常基础但重要的关键字,合理使用它可以提高代码的可读性和规范性。理解“函数形参为`void`”的含义,有助于更好地编写和维护程序。希望本文能帮助你更清晰地掌握这一知识点。
C语言中的函数形参为void是什么意思